[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

ANTS on Janos




Hi there!
With Tim Stack's help I ave been almost able to run ANTS over Janos...
Right now it is having a rather strange behaviour:
With a Wrong .routes file, the Image would boot and run my own ANTS 
application correctly (although the Ethernet frames being sent had 
sender=receiver)...

Now that I fixed the entries of that file I get this when trying to boot/run 
my app...

cheers

A

Exception starting new mid in Flow[name=Protocol 
ants.core.DLProtocol;obj=Node[a=18.31.12.1];inChan-count=1;outChan-count=0]: 
flow.loadClass('ants.core.DLRequestCapsule') threw 
java.lang.ExceptionInInitializerError: [exception was 
edu.utah.janosvm.sys.SegmentationFaultError: Team(`Credentials[root cred]-0', 
2).static-data(0x170a508).field = Team(`Credentials[dlprotocol:b99b0b..]-1', 
3).[B(0x17a08a0);]
java.lang.ClassNotFoundException: 
flow.loadClass('ants.core.DLRequestCapsule') threw 
java.lang.ExceptionInInitializerError: [exception was 
edu.utah.janosvm.sys.SegmentationFaultError: Team(`Credentials[root cred]-0', 
2).static-data(0x170a508).field = Team(`Credentials[dlprotocol:b99b0b..]-1', 
3).[B(0x17a08a0);]
         at java.lang.Throwable.fillInStackTrace(Throwable.java:native)
         at java.lang.Throwable.<init>(Throwable.java:40)
         at java.lang.Exception.<init>(Exception.java:24)
         at 
java.lang.ClassNotFoundException.<init>(ClassNotFoundException.java:23)
         at ants.core.CodeGroup.register(CodeGroup.java:239)
         at ants.core.CodeGroup.activate(CodeGroup.java:298)
         at ants.core.Protocol.activate(Protocol.java:299)
         at ants.core.DLProtocol.activate(DLProtocol.java:88)
         at ants.core.ProtocolBooster.dispatch(ProtocolBooster.java:251)
         at ants.core.ProtocolBooster.msgLoop(ProtocolBooster.java:162)
         at ants.core.ProtocolBooster.access$0(ProtocolBooster.java:line 
unknown, pc 
0x17fb11a)
         at ants.core.ProtocolBooster$1.run(ProtocolBooster.java:141)

ABORT:
Protocol registration blew up:
java.lang.ClassNotFoundException: 
flow.loadClass('ants.core.DLRequestCapsule') threw 
java.lang.NoClassDefFoundError: ants/core/DLRequestCapsule
         at java.lang.Throwable.fillInStackTrace(Throwable.java:native)
         at java.lang.Throwable.<init>(Throwable.java:40)
         at java.lang.Exception.<init>(Exception.java:24)
         at 
java.lang.ClassNotFoundException.<init>(ClassNotFoundException.java:23)
         at ants.core.CodeGroup.register(CodeGroup.java:239)
         at ants.core.Protocol.activate(Protocol.java:297)
         at ants.core.DLProtocol.activate(DLProtocol.java:88)
         at ants.core.Node.register(Node.java:336)
         at ants.core.Node.register(Node.java:320)
         at ants.core.PrimordialNode.start(PrimordialNode.java:395)
         at ants.core.ConfigurationManager.run(ConfigurationManager.java:402)
         at 
edu.utah.janos.nodeos.FlowInitializer.startInitialClass(FlowInitializer.java:133)
         at edu.utah.janos.nodeos.FlowInitializer.run(FlowInitializer.java:86)

/oskit/janosvm-0.5.1/libraries/extensions/nodeos/clib/flowResource.c:173: 
failed assertion `err == 0'
Backtrace tid:1 P:00373020: eip:0x002378b4 fp:0x00363e08
         00237951 00239010 0023765c 0022dd17 00227ffc 002220e9 00125931 
0012561c 
00249286
Backtrace tid:2 P:0115c000: eip:0x002378b4 fp:0x0114af18
         00237951 002357e1 0022b75e 00236718
Backtrace tid:3 P:0115e000: eip:0x002378b4 fp:0x01152f80
         00237951 002357e1 0022b75e 00236718
Backtrace tid:4 P:01160000: eip:0x002378b4 fp:0x0115afe8
         00237951 002357e1 0022b75e 00236718
Backtrace tid:5 P:01162000: eip:0x002378b4 fp:0x01169e88
         00237951 002357e1 00234b66 0022bb62 00236718
Backtrace tid:6 P:01824000: eip:0x002378b4 fp:0x013ebcd8
         00237951 002356c8 0022d055 0022aa7a 001aa191 001653db 0014518c 
0017d876 
001a20fc 0022ba1e 00236718
Backtrace tid:7 P:01826000: eip:0x002378b4 fp:0x013f2cb8
         00237951 002356c8 0022d055 0022aa7a 001aa191 001653db 00144844 
0017d876 
001a20fc 0022ba1e 00236718
Backtrace tid:9 P:0182b000: eip:0x002378b4 fp:0x015f9ed8
         00237951 002357e1 0022b75e 00236718
Backtrace tid:10 P:0182d000: eip:0x002378b4 fp:0x01602ed8
         00237951 002357e1 0022b75e 00236718
Backtrace tid:11 P:0182f000: eip:0x002378b4 fp:0x0160bed8
         00237951 002357e1 0022b75e 00236718
Backtrace tid:12 P:01831000: eip:0x002378b4 fp:0x01614ed8
         00237951 002357e1 0022b75e 00236718
Backtrace tid:13 P:01833000: eip:0x002378b4 fp:0x0161eed8
         00237951 002357e1 0022b75e 00236718
Backtrace tid:14 P:01835000: eip:0x002378b4 fp:0x01628720
         00237951 002356c8 0022d055 0022aa7a 001aa191 001653db 00118b5d 
0135b403 
016ba2dc 0166d7a6 0166d6b5 0174b96d 01765383 0174889b 01767118 0172bb7b
Backtrace tid:15 P:01837000: eip:0x002378b4 fp:0x01632830
         00237951 002356c8 0022d055 0022aa7a 001aa191 001653db 00118b5d 
0135b403 
016ba2dc 0166d7a6 0166d6b5 0174dc95 0017c428 00159da1 0017e4c3 001a5f95
Backtrace tid:16 P:01839000: eip:0x002378b4 fp:0x0163c7dc
         00237951 002356c8 0022d055 0022aa7a 001aa191 001653db 00118b5d 
0135b403 
016ba2dc 0166d7a6 0166d6b5 016b1cbb 015b76a1 016d9087 0017c428 00159da1
Backtrace tid:17 P:0183b000: eip:0x002378b4 fp:0x01646740
         00237951 0023599d 0022d0bc 0022aa7a 001aa420 001653db 00118b5d 
0135b403 
016ba2dc 016c5907 016955dd 0169551f 0169539f 0167ce8a 016c310c 0017c428
Backtrace tid:18 P:0183d000: eip:0x002378b4 fp:0x01650ed8
         00237951 002357e1 0022b75e 00236718
Backtrace tid:19 P:0183f000: eip:0x002378b4 fp:0x0165ecd8
         00237951 002356c8 0022d055 0022aa7a 001aa191 001653db 0014518c 
0017d876 
001a20fc 0022ba1e 00236718
Backtrace tid:20 P:01841000: eip:0x002378b4 fp:0x01665cb8
         00237951 002356c8 0022d055 0022aa7a 001aa191 001653db 00144844 
0017d876 
001a20fc 0022ba1e 00236718
Backtrace tid:21 P:01843000: eip:0x002378b4 fp:0x017aced8
         00237951 002357e1 0022b75e 00236718
Backtrace tid:22 P:01845000: eip:0x002378b4 fp:0x017b3ed8
         00237951 002357e1 0022b75e 00236718
Backtrace tid:23 P:01847000: eip:0x002378b4 fp:0x017baed8
         00237951 002357e1 0022b75e 00236718
Backtrace tid:24 P:01849000: eip:0x002378b4 fp:0x017c1ed8
         00237951 002357e1 0022b75e 00236718
Backtrace tid:25 P:0184b000: eip:0x002378b4 fp:0x017c8ed8
         00237951 002357e1 0022b75e 00236718
Backtrace tid:26 P:0184d000: eip:0x002378b4 fp:0x017cfed8
         00237951 002357e1 0022b75e 00236718
Backtrace tid:27 P:0184f000: eip:0x002378b4 fp:0x017d6ed8
         00237951 002357e1 0022b75e 00236718
Backtrace tid:28 P:01851000: eip:0x002378b4 fp:0x017dded8
         00237951 002357e1 0022b75e 00236718
Backtrace tid:30 P:01855000: eip:0x002378b4 fp:0x017f1f44
         00237951 00236244 0023615d 0023671e
Tid:0x8 P:01828000
Backtrace: fp=1406928
 002517b9 0010ec67 001f9ddd 001cd1ff 001d3547 001d67c4 01379709 013d5def
 013e3b8d 01348eb0 0017c428 00159da1 0017e4c3 0017ddd4 0017ddba 001a20fc
 0022ba1e 00236718




[ Janos ] [ OSKit ] [ Network Testbed ] [ Flick ] [ Fluke ]
Flux Research Group / Department of Computer Science / University of Utah